Thai Orchid

Thai Orchid is a thai restaurant Santa Cruz Westside located in Santa Cruz.

8 / 10
0
ratings
  • Phone

    (831) 425-2206

  • Website

    thaisantacruz.com

  • Facebook

    115755221787411

  • Type

    Thai Restaurant

Address

2238 Mission St (at Fair) Santa Cruz , CA 95060 United States

Comments / 4


Janet Geluardi

Great food. Best Thai in Santa Cruz I think and I'm a snob. Panang curry , local fish special, lawn, delicious!

Athonia Cappelli

I agree with Duncan. The ice water is good. Best on the west side even?

Duncan

Ice water is quite good here.

Susan Cannon

Take out orders only take about 10 minutes to prepare.

Similar places nearby :

8.2
Thai
Sabieng Thai Cuisine

Try the Thai iced coffee. So good! I get it with coconut milk instead of regular. - feron mcgurrin

8.0
Thai
Real Thai Kitchen

Vegan options abound at the lunch buffet. Salad dressing has mayo but items like spicy tofu, green vegi curry & Tom Kha Tofu appear totally free of animal products. Spicy tofu is just that! Cha-chow! - Athonia Cappelli

6.1
Thai
Sawasdee By The Sea

Chicken wings, wontons, the curries... haven't had a bad dish yet. - Marek Minecki